Morgan Stanley is a leading global financial services firm providing a wide range of investment banking securities investment management and wealth management services. Morgan Stanley Wealth Management (MSWM) has over $2 trillion under management and is one of the worlds largest networks of Financial Advisors.


Institutional Infrastructure Solutions (IIS) a business unit within Corporate & Institutional Solutions is an integrated client service solution for institutional and family office clients. IIS supports clients in partnership with Financial Advisors Morgan Stanley Family Office (MSFO) Outsourced Chief Investment Office (OCIO) Morgan Stanley Fund Services Graystone Consulting and Wealth Management Operations. IIS is responsible for all client service execution processes including Client Onboarding & Maintenance Investment Execution Asset Aggregation Accounting Reporting & Analytics and Billing.


IIS is looking for an entrepreneurial ambitious and intellectually curious professional to join the Institutional Reporting Team. The candidate plays a vital role maintaining accurate data in performance reporting systems adhering to all policies and procedures and contributing to operational process improvements. The candidate will collaborate and partner closely with client coverage teams investment officers and financial advisors to deliver timely and accurate performance reports.


Primary Responsibilities:

  • Compile and generate monthly and quarterly performance reports reconcile performance discrepancies and ensure accuracy of data through self-audit

  • Manually capture and reconcile alternative investment transactions and valuations into designated systems and spreadsheets

  • Responsible for collecting processing managing and analyzing large amount of data and creating programs to automate processes

  • Process review and resolve any exception items to ensure accurate reporting of client investments

  • Review investment activity performance and cash flows daily to ensure data quality across accounts entities and clients

  • Plan organize and prioritize assignments to consistently meet high standards of reporting timeliness and accuracy

  • Develop as a subject matter expert and support cross-functional teams by being accessible responsive and delivering timely feedback

  • Understand and effectively utilize the groups systems infrastructure platforms and business processes

  • Increase the effectiveness of the Reporting Team by identifying gaps and recommending/providing training and development opportunities for other Team members

  • Regularly seek opportunities to use firm resources for peer sharing and collaborating across the team

  • Actively engage in available training and education programs to maintain current status on policies procedures and risk awareness

  • Interface and maintain strong relationships with internal and external stakeholders including research trading operations product specialists third party vendors and custodians

Knowledge and Skills Required:

  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office including Excel PowerPoint and Access

  • Experience and knowledge of wealth management platforms and vehicles including managed accounts mutual funds ETFs separate accounts and alternative investments

  • Detailed understanding of performance calculations including measurement and attribution

  • Detailed understanding of alternative investments and their corresponding transactions including private equity hedge funds and direct investments

  • Must be detail-oriented with an ability to multi-task and manage competing priorities

  • Strong strategic thinking and problem-solving skills with the ability to clearly define a problem synthesize data to derive fact-based insights and provide insightful and actionable recommendations

  • Strong organizational and project management skills

  • Ability to work independently and effectively on a team with demonstrated leadership abilities

  • Technical background with strong analytical and quantitative skills

  • Exemplary verbal and written communication skills

Qualifications

  • 3 years portfolio accounting or investment reporting experience serving institutional and ultra-high net worth clients

  • Firm understanding of portfolio management concepts including modern portfolio theory asset allocation portfolio construction manager selection risk management and performance attribution

  • Experience with Addepar Investment Metrics or other investment reporting platforms a plus

  • Experience working with complex datasets and relational databases. Experience with Dataiku a plus but not required

  • Technical background with strong analytical and quantitative skills; proficient in SQL Python or Excel VBA a plus

  • Undergraduate degree in accounting finance economics data or related field

  • FINRA Series 7 and 66 is a plus though not required

  • Industry designations including CIPM CFA or significant progress preferred but not required
